Egypt set to increase cigarette and alcohol prices

In its general session on Sunday, the Egyptian House of Representatives approved a government-proposed bill to amend certain provisions of Law #67 of 2016 concerning the Value Added Tax (VAT). The amendments aim to bolster the state's financial resources and enhance tax and social justice. The bill, presented to the plenary session, includes a provision to increase the minimum and maximum prices of cigarettes by 12 percent annually for three years, starting from November 2025. The bill also allows for the possibility of reducing this percentage based on production costs. Furthermore, the legislation will convert the tax on alcoholic beverages from a percentage-based system to a fixed-rate system, with progressive taxes imposed based on alcohol content. This will be accompanied by an annual increase of 15 percent for three years. The proposed law also stipulates subjecting the services of literary agencies and certain media services to VAT, while abolishing previous tax exemptions on these services to boost state revenues. Additionally, crude oil will be subjected to a 10 percent tax, with the cancellation of its previous tax exemption to further enhance public revenues. The head of the Tobacco Division, Ibrahim Imbabi, told local media that the minimum price for the first tier of cigarettes has been raised to LE48, up from LE38.8. This allows tobacco companies to increase prices up to this value. He added that the second tier's maximum price has been raised to LE69, replacing the previous LE48, with the third tier beginning at LE 69 and above.
